Transaction 33a35542c74e4e3b9d719a989d5864823048db4572b9d3953cd9bdea4d68c242
1 Input
1 Output
-
33a35542c74e4e3b9d719a989d5864823048db4572b9d3953cd9bdea4d68c242:0
- value
- 505883
- script pubkey
- OP_0 OP_PUSHBYTES_32 d7642e2434c1a9a4aaac0b55ace38d631fc9f78d834798b1fb7c97a4adcc1ef1
- address
- bc1q6ajzufp5cx56f24vpd26ecudvv0unaudsdre3v0m0jt6ftwvrmcscp3mgf